About Spectacle Shoal Lighthouse
Also known as: Spectacles
Spectacle Shoal Lighthouse is a 6-meter-tall cylindrical concrete tower. Its focal height reaches 8 meters. The tower, painted white with a red band at its apex, rests upon a pentagonal concrete pier. Located on Spectacle Shoal, it emits a red light with a flashing characteristic of Fl R 4s, offering a 9.7-nautical-mile visibility range. The site is accessible to the public, though the tower remains closed. Clayton, the closest port, is 5.6 kilometers distant.
Why it matters: This navigation aid marks Spectacle Shoal, a submerged hazard in Canadian waters. Its red flashing light serves as a warning for boats navigating nearby routes.
